Solitary-foundation powder types include nitrocellulose as their primary explosive part. These smokeless powder formulations typically burn at reduced temperatures and demonstrate a lot more predictable tension progress curves.

Nitrocellulose includes insufficient oxygen to fully oxidize its carbon and hydrogen. The oxygen deficit is greater by addition of graphite and natural stabilizers. Items of combustion inside the gun barrel include flammable gasses like hydrogen and carbon monoxide.

A modified Edition, Cordite MD, entered service in 1901, Together with the guncotton percentage enhanced to sixty five% and nitroglycerine reduced to 30%. This change lowered the combustion temperature and as a result erosion and barrel put on. Graphite is employed being a coating to aid powder managing, and it Is that this graphite coating that provides smokeless powder it usual gray colour. Stabilizing brokers also are additional to modern-day powders to improve storage lifestyle.

This quick burning releases a large quantity of expanding gasses which, if confined within the chamber of a firearm, accelerate the bullet (or shot demand) down the barrel, developing a high velocity in an exceptionally small length.
